LLY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2026 in Review

4,353 of the 8,130 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Eli Lilly (LLY) for Q1 2026, worth a combined $714B — down 16% from $848B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 236 funds opened new LLY positions and 229 closed out — a net gain of 7 holders — while 1,935 added to existing stakes and 1,696 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fifth Third Bancorp, adding an estimated $1.52B. The largest seller was J. Stern & Co, cutting an estimated $4.1B.
